Is it possible to hide New Arrivals, Best Sellers, & Specials from the Homepage as well as under the "Other Links"?
I went into Marketing and Manage New Arrivals, etc and changed everything to "no" and set the number of products to "0" but it still says "New Arrivals under Other Links and on the Homepage. Is it possible to hide these?

Hi Nas,
I think you mak be changing on a different admin page, so changing how many are shown elsewhere. Go to Marketing > Manage Home Page and there is a section there called "Products to Show" - Change the numbers to zero there and t should accept them and hide the sections. |
